About
FBC: Firebreak is a cooperative first-person shooter set within a mysterious federal agency under assault by otherworldly forces. As a years-long siege on the agency’s headquarters reaches a breakpoint, only Firebreak— the Bureau’s most versatile unit—has the gear and the guts to plunge into the building’s strangest crises, restore order, contain the chaos, and fight to reclaim control.

Dive into the Federal Bureau of Control’s (FBC) unpredictable and extradimensional headquarters during its darkest—and strangest—hours. As one of the FBC’s fearless first responders, you and your team are on call to confront everything from reality-warping anomalies to otherworldly monsters... no matter the odds. Will you contain the chaos or finally lose control?

Join forces with friends or strangers to tackle each crisis as a well-oiled crew. Survival in this three-player cooperative FPS hinges on quick thinking and seamless teamwork as you scramble to tame raging paranatural crises across a variety of unexpected locations. Improve your odds by utilizing the tools and skills that make you unique or improvising with whatever’s on hand to support your crew.

Before deploying, select your weapon and customize your Firebreaker’s Crisis Kit with specialized tools, grenades, support items, and paranatural augments... then modify them to suit your strategy and change the way you play. Experiment with different loadouts to perfect your playstyle and synergize with your team, giving you the edge to succeed in every crisis, no matter the difficulty.

Return to the strange and unexpected world of Control or venture in for the first time in this standalone, multiplayer experience. Discover the iconic and unfathomable headquarters of the FBC — the Oldest House — from an entirely new perspective as a team of volunteer first responders who'll stop at nothing to save what's left of the Bureau.

As it's cheap and pretty much done, my thoughts are that it's pretty good for a PVE shooter, but too complex for its own good. I like it, but levels can turn pretty stressful at the end when you're dealing with so many weird things and trying to explain to people what to do makes it less fun. "Stop focusing on the radioactive pearls, get the Blackrock launcher and shoot that postbox!" is a fun thing to yell, but pretty hard to explain to people new to the universe The endless mode has been the best for introducing people, it's simple and shows that the gunplay is fun. I recommend it, if you have patience and a couple of friends to rope in
This game is pretty fun, when the game first released it was quite buggy, slow and unreliable. But now it's very much fun, I experience very little game breaking bugs or performance issues, the only thing that will vary your experience is how many people are actively online playing the game, and if you have any friends to play with, because otherwise you will be playing on your own for the most part. People expect this game to be like or very closely related to Control in terms of mechanics, storyline, playtime etc, but this is far from what the game is intended to be, did you enjoy mowing down waves of Hiss in the Old House as Jessie? Did you hate how your health was very precious in Control and how often you'd die if you get overrun by a little more than twenty Hiss? Then I'm sure you'll like this game because combat is actually quite fun, of course the slow grinding to get a higher rank, more abilities unlocked, and leveling up your chosen toolkit will be a bit of a hassle and realistically will restrict you to Easy to Medium jobs until you get past Level 30 or so. However. if you're playing on any difficulty higher than Medium, prepare for an endless onslaught of waves and waves of high-level Hiss enemies, whether its waves and hordes of Elevated Hiss, or regular Grunts, it will be very difficult to mow your way through them, and they will keep on spawning even if a wave just spawned, and the amount of active Hiss enemies will stack overtime and can make completing the mission impossible if you aren't strategically planning where to place your turrets, water barrels, or your speakers. Make sure you are aware of this before complaining about how hard the game is at higher difficulties, I think it is way too difficult for some people like myself, but others will find it a good challenge, just manage your expectations. I wish this game got more missions than the five we received, but endless mode is a cool feature, and the ability to invite friends to download a "friend copy" of the game to play with you, without even needing to buy one is an amazing idea, and I wish more games did things like this. This game is worth it any price level, but the best time is to get it when it is on sale.

Came in after the "Final" Patch , definitely has some Major stability issues especially at higher difficulties with the game crashing / Extraction Elevator door not opening causing a frustrating mission fail. But besides that , Absolutely fun and engaging experience. The Gunplay is one of the best feeling ones i've had the pleasure of, you can tell the love poured into the animations (especially the inspects) and punchy and high-energy sound design. The Classes are also very fun and well animated , i love jumping around with the Electric Pogo-stick. It is a valid criticism that it needs more content , the classes while fun are very few with only 3 and i unlocked all 12 weapons after 16 hours of play, there are only 6 missions with a small variety of objective changes between runs. All in all , had a lovely time so far , hopefully the issues will be fixed in a future patch and if Control : Resonant is a commercial success , maybe they'll take a look back at Firebreak for more content.
